Depends on the version and the situation. I havn't driven the 599 which is reported to be a big improvement over a 430, that was an improvement over the 360, which......
Street usage is all about the ability of the car's brain to slip the clutch when stuck in traffic, and when hill starting and the like. The 355 was really bad here as it only had the choice to bite in set increments (7 iirc) and so it struggled to be smooth. Once underway they all get better, and higher revs smooth things a lot.
Much is made of the famed Ferrari open gate. It has brilliant feel, but it still isn't fool proof. It is possible (even with some wheel time) to hit the end of one of the "fingers" and end in nuteral, the Lamborghini gate has these champhered and I have never had the same issue there.
